问题概述:用户反馈“TP钱包打不开网页”通常表现为内置浏览器/DApp页面空白、加载失败或卡在转圈。原因多层次,既可能是本地环境问题,也可能是后端链节点或平台架构故障。
一、可能原因归类
1. 本地网络与设备
- DNS、运营商或防火墙拦截、企业/校园网策略、VPN干扰;
- 设备系统时间错误导致TLS证书校验失败;
- 应用WebView或浏览器内核异常、缓存损坏、旧版本兼容性问题。
2. RPC节点与区块链网络
- 连接的RPC节点宕机或响应慢,或被限流;
- 链上拥堵、交易池积压、叔块(uncle block)增多导致确认延迟;

- 节点数据不同步或分叉导致请求返回异常数据。
3. 平台后端与负载均衡
- 负载均衡器配置不当(健康检查失败、会话粘性问题、不均匀流量分配)或CDN缓存策略错误;
- 后端服务实例自动伸缩异常、数据库连接耗尽、限流/熔断触发。
4. 合约与DApp兼管
- 智能合约ABI或接口变更、合约升级未经前端适配;
- CORS或meta-mask/Web3注入兼容性问题;
- 合约管理权限问题(管理员地址变化、多签未通过)导致合约调用失败。
5. 账户与安全
- 非托管账户私钥/助记词损坏或误配,账户被锁定;
- 多重签名或合约账户未签名完成;
- 本地加密存储损坏导致钱包无法读取账户。
二、全球科技支付服务平台架构要点(建议)
- 多活部署:在全球主要区域部署RPC节点、网关和CDN,采用Anycast或地理DNS进行流量引导;
- 负载均衡:结合L4/L7负载均衡、健康检查、熔断与自动扩缩容,针对长连接与短请求分别优化;
- 可观测性:链上/链下指标、链同步延迟、RPC延时、错误率、用户侧加载时间统一采集并告警;
- 灾备与回滚:智能合约部署使用代理/可升级模式并保留回滚策略,合约变更走多签治理流程。
三、账户特点与管理实践
- 非托管(客户端持有私钥)与托管(平台KMS)并存,提供助记词导出、冷钱包支持与多签方案;
- 推荐使用HD钱包(BIP32/39/44)进行地址派生、并明确链ID匹配规则;
- 多签与权限管理采用智能合约或Gnosis类方案,重大变更需链下审批+链上签名。
四、合约管理策略
- 版本化与接口兼容:合约ABI变更需发布新版本并在前端实现适配层;
- 升级治理:采用代理合约、限权多签与时锁机制,合约发布流程纳入CI/CD与审计;
- 回滚与应急:保留旧合约入口与资产迁移方案,紧急情况下启用预置的迁移合约或暂停功能。
五、数据加密方案(传输与存储)
- 传输层:强制TLS1.2+/HTTPs,验证证书链与公钥钉扎(pinning)可选;
- 存储层:敏感数据-at rest 使用AES-GCM或ChaCha20-Poly1305加密,配合分段加密与密钥轮换;
- 密钥管理:使用云KMS或自建HSM管理主密钥,私钥签名在安全环境(Secure Enclave / HSM / TPM)完成;
- 客户端:助记词使用PBKDF2/Argon2进行派生与本地加密,禁止明文存储;
- 审计与合规:完整加密日志策略、密钥使用审计与定期渗透测试。
六、叔块(uncle block)说明与影响
- 叔块是区块链网络中因传播延迟等原因产生的“孤立但被承认”的区块(以太坊称uncle);
- 叔块本身会影响出块奖励与网络效率,短期内可能导致交易确认时间波动;
- 对钱包表现:当节点经历链重组或大量叔块时,查询交易状态可能出现波动或短暂不可用,前端应设计重试与确认深度策略。
七、用户端快速排查与修复建议
1. 检查网络、关闭或切换VPN,确认系统时间准确;
2. 清理应用缓存或重启App,升级到最新版本;
3. 在钱包设置中切换或手动添加RPC/节点(使用公共节点或官方备用节点);
4. 允许应用所需权限(网络、存储),或尝试桌面钱包/浏览器插件访问相同DApp;
5. 导出助记词后在另一设备导入(谨慎操作,保护隐私),排除本地存储损坏;
6. 若为合约调用失败,查看区块浏览器交易回执与日志,联系DApp或合约方确认版本变更;

7. 若为平台服务故障,关注官方渠道通告并联系支持提供节点/时间戳与日志帮助定位。
结论:TP钱包打不开网页可能源于本地环境、RPC节点、平台负载均衡或合约/账户问题。面向全球科技支付服务平台,应采用多活节点、健壮负载均衡、可升级合约治理与严格密钥管理;用户端通过网络校验、节点切换与版本升级多数可自助恢复。遇到链上异常(如叔块增多或分叉)需等待网络稳定并按确认深度处理交易。
评论
Alex
很实用的排查清单,我先试着换个RPC节点再看。
小梅
关于叔块的解释很清晰,原来会影响确认速度。
CryptoCat
建议在“负载均衡”部分补充一下客户端重试与指数回退策略。
张磊
遇到过类似问题,按文中方法清缓存+切节点就好了,赞!